Please ensure Javascript is enabled for purposes of website accessibility
Powered by Zoomin Software. For more details please contactZoomin

Apps, Widgets, and Controls

Unshelve​.Priority() method

  • Last UpdatedJul 19, 2024
  • 1 minute read

The Unshelve.Priority() method unshelves currently shelved alarms within a specified alarm priority range that belong to the same specified provider and alarm group.

Syntax

AlarmClient.Unshelve.Priority("ProviderName","GroupName",FromPriority,ToPriority,"Duration=<Duration>;Reason="+"<Reason>"+"UnShelved"+"<Description>"+";");

Parameters

ProviderName

Node and provider name combination that specifies the origin of alarm monitoring.

GroupName

Alarm group or area name whose alarms are monitored by the Alarm Control.

FromPriority

Three-digit starting point of the alarm priority range. The FromPriority value must be less than the ToPriority value.

ToPriority

Three-digit end point of the alarm priority range. The ToPriority value must be greater than the FromPriority value.

Duration

Duration must be set to 0 to unshelve alarms.

Reason

Explanation up to 200 characters for unshelving all alarms belonging to a specified alarm priority range.

An explanation is optional to unshelve alarms and the Reason parameter can be specified as Reason="" to indicate a null explanation.

Example

AlarmClient1.Unshelve.Priority("\Galaxy","Area_001",100,600,"Duration=0;Reason="+""""+"UnShelved"+""""+";");

Remarks

For more information about unshelving alarms, see Unshelve Alarms.

In This Topic
TitleResults for “How to create a CRG?”Also Available in